Abstract

689,513. Automatic circuit-breakers. HEIDENWOLF, H., and NAIMER, H. Nov. 28, 1950 [Nov. 28, 1949], No. 29142/50. Class 38 (v) Excessive current in a coil 19 heats and so varies the permeability of a magnetic member 11 that a permanent magnet 16, the poles 17 of which have been engaging the member 11, is released and under the bias of a spring 14 moves into the position shown. A circuit between contacts 5, 6 and which includes the coil 19 and two spring contacts 8 normally bridged by the magnet is thereby broken. An exceptionally high current either D.C. or A.C. through the coil 19 will also release the magnet instantaneously by acting in opposition to the magnet and release may also be assisted by making the contact arms 8 of bimetal so that when heated they press upwards against the magnet with increasing strength. The device is reset by pressing down a button 26 which carries with it two arms 28 bearing on a collar 15 on the rod 13 carrying the magnet. This brings the magnet sufficiently near to the member 11 for the movement to be completed by magnetic attraction, unless the overload persists. The button 26 cannot by itself push the magnet into engagement since after a certain movement the arms 28 encounter a bar 31 and are forced apart. In a modification, Fig. 5, the permanent magnet 40 is fixed but two movable magnetic arms 41, 42, engage the ends of the heated member 43 and the contacts 44.
